Spring

Flowers are blooming and trees and bushes are beginning to grow new leaves. It's time for spring clean-up. We recommend raking winter debris and leaves, thatching, aerating, mowing, edging, pruning, and fertilizing.

Summer

The sun is out, the days are long, and backyard barbecues are back in style. It's time to get outside and enjoy your manicured lawn. We recommend fertilizing, pulling and spot treating weeds, mowing, edging, and pruning.

Fall

It's fall, the scent of pumpkin spice is in the air, Halloween decorations are going up, and leaves are raining down. It's our favorite time of year! It's also a great time to thatch, aerate, seed, fertilize, and prepare your lawn for winter.

Keeping your lawn looking great isn’t rocket science, however, it does take time and attention to detail.  We recommend starting each spring with a soil test, the soil is the foundation on which your lawn is built.  Soil tests are inexpensive and it’s worth the investment to determine whether your soil is acidic or alkaline before you spend money on fertilizer and other soil amendments. There is no better way to  jump-start your lawn than with a

proper mowing and edging. We also highly recommend aerating, thatching, and over-seeding your lawn at least once per year. Lawn aeration helps to dry out wet soils and allows water and fertilizer to penetrate the soil better. Thatching your lawn removes excess and dead vegetation and over-seeding adds new grass to the lawn creating a healthier and fuller appearance.
